They don't make them like this anymore.
Likes
My wife used this recently on a 2 day trip. The straps are more comfortable than most packs. She also like the lumbar support. Plenty of space and pockets. We used the built in day pack/hydration pack carrier and it worked great. The front of the back has a zip up nylon? pocket vs. a mesh pocket like a lot of other packs. I don't feel like the mesh front pocket will hold up over time. You can also unzip it like a suitcase which we found to be very convenient. This pack just feels like it will hold up over time vs. packs that have a lot of mesh pockets all over. Another great feature is the angled water bottle pocket that you can pull out. You can actually reach your bottle without taking off your pack.
Dislikes
Still has those mesh side pockets. I feel like those are going to rip sooner or later.

06/17/17
Comfortable and handy
Likes
Love all the pockets, rain cover. Huge holds everything I need. Even the bear canister. My old backpack was totally taken over by the bear canister. Comfortable. Great top loader with three large of pockets. The inside zippered pocket is great for stowing important items you can't afford to lose. Huge outside zipper pocket. Clips for poles work--not as easy as Osprey, but they do work. May need a little assistance from a hiking partner to use them without taking off your backpack. The compression straps clip on and off, a very good feature compared to maven. Can't beat the comfort of this pack adjustable for short people--that's me.
Dislikes
The summit bag is a waste of weight. It's too small to carry enough essentials for a day hike, although I did hike with someone who used it for this purpose. It appears you can use the straps for holding a bag or tent on the bottom of the pack to use as a waste belt. You'd have to be pretty close to the summit or have perfect weather to use this. I may leave it home next time I go backpacking. Prefer the system on the Maven 35 I bought. Removable sleeping bag divider is too small- leave it home.
